Shock Related Notices
!
WARNING
Do not insert a wire or metal objects into a vent or disk drive slot. There is a risk
of an electric shock.
Do not let water or foreign objects (e.g., pins or paper clips) ent er the equipment.
There is a risk of a fire, electric shock, and breakdown. W hen such objects
accidentally enter the equipment, immediately turn off the po wer and unplug the
cord. Contact your sales agent instead of trying to disassem ble it yourself.
Do not plug/unplug a power cord with a wet hand. There is a r isk of an electric
shock.
Make sure to power off the server and unplug the power cord f rom a power outlet
before installing/removing any optional interna l device or
connecting/disconnecting any interface cable to/from the s erver. If the server is
powered off, but its power cord is plugged to a power sourc e, touching an internal
device, cable, or connector may cause an electric shoc k or a fire.
Unless described herein, never attempt to disassem ble, repair, or alter the
equipment. There is a risk of an electric shock or f ire as well as malfunction.
You may want to unplug the equipment if a thunderstorm is eminent. Do NOT
touch the equipment and cables during a thunderstorm in your area. There is a
risk of a fire or electric shock.
Make sure to power off the server and disconnect the power plug f rom a power
outlet before cleaning or installing/removing internal optional devices. Touching
any internal device of the server with its power cord connected to a power source
may cause an electric shock even of the server is off -powered.
